Terumo to acquire OrganOx in landmark deal expanding opportunities for organ transplantation worldwide

ARC Oxford members and Oxford University spinout OrganOx has been acquired by Tokyo based Terumo in USD $1.5 billion deal*1.

Founded in 2008 by Professor Peter Friend and Professor Constantin Coussios, OrganOx is a pioneering medical technology company specialising in advanced organ preservation devices for Normothermic Machine Perfusion (NMP). NMP and other ex-vivo machine perfusion (EVMP) technologies can preserve organs longer by circulating oxygen and nutrient rich perfusate through the organ at near-body temperature. In addition, NMP devices enable real-time monitoring of organ condition during storage and transport. This aims to help prevent the transplantation of organs with impaired function – with the goal of improving transplant success rates – as well as leading to a more effective use of organ from marginal donors.

The acquisition marks Terumo’s strategic entry into the organ transplantation-related sector – a field with significant unmet medial needs and strong growth potential. By combining Terumo’s long-standing expertise in designing medical devices and equipment with OrganOx’s advanced capabilities in NMP, the Company aims to deliver innovative organ preservation devices globally. Terumo seeks to broaden access for patients in need of transplants and contribute to the advancement of transplantation medicine, by aiming to address key challenges in organ transplantation, including improving organ utilisation rates, enabling the use of marginal donor*2 organs, enhancing post-transplant outcomes, and reducing the burden on healthcare professionals through minimising night-time and emergency procedures.

OrganOx’s liver NMP device, metra, received FDA approval in 2021 and was launched in the US market in 2022. The device has also obtained regulatory approvals in the EU, UK, Australia, and Canada, and is currently being commercialised in all these regions. To date, the device has been used in over 6,000 liver transplant procedures worldwide.

*2 Marginal donors are individuals who fall outside the standard criteria for organ donation—due to factors such as advanced age, pre-existing medical conditions, or donation following cardiac death. Expanding the use of organs from marginal donors is expected to increase the availability of transplantable organs and contribute to reducing the number of patients on transplant waiting lists.
